MacG Apologizes After False Claims About Nkosazana Daughter and Sir Trill, Faces R13 Million Lawsuit

MacG, a popular podcaster, recently made headlines after accusing musician Sir Trill of not supporting his alleged child with singer Nkosazana Daughter. However, Nkosazana Daughter has since disputed these claims, confirming that she was indeed in a relationship with Sir Trill, but denying any romantic involvement with music producer Master KG, who MacG alleged was the actual father of her child.

Nkosazana Daughter took to social media to express her disappointment and frustration with MacG’s claims, stating that her relationship with Master KG was strictly professional. She also slammed MacG for spreading false narratives and disrespecting women in the industry.

MacG has since apologized to Nkosazana Daughter, acknowledging that he was wrong to make those claims. However, the damage had already been done, and Nkosazana Daughter has reportedly filed a R13 million lawsuit against MacG for defamation.

The incident has sparked a wider conversation about the importance of verifying information before sharing it publicly, especially when it concerns sensitive topics like paternity and personal relationships. It’s a valuable lesson for influencers and media personalities to be mindful of the impact their words can have on others.

This controversy serves as a reminder of the responsibility that comes with having a public platform. MacG’s apology and willingness to make amends are steps in the right direction, but the incident highlights the need for greater accountability and sensitivity in the entertainment industry.
